Ronald “Andy” Davenport, 75, of Peebles, left this world on Saturday, October 11, 2025 at the Ohio Valley Hospice of Hope Inpatient Center in Seaman. He was born August 7, 1950 in West Union, Ohio to Archie and Jessie (Adams) Davenport. The youngest of six children, he was preceded in death by his parents, an infant daughter, Jessica and his siblings, Evelyn, Nola Rostine, Wilbur Eugene (Bonnie), Harry Douglas (Alvina) and Marguerite Bellew (Kenneth); also a nephew and a niece.
On November 6, 1971 he married Janice Wallace of Winchester. They became the parents of baby Jessica, Eric Joseph (Shelley) of Peebles and Sara Davine Pomeroy (Sid) of Fort Thomas, Kentucky.
Andy and Jan were blessed with two grandsons, Keegan Joseph (and special friend Maggie Bauer) of Peebles and Jack Sutton Pomeroy of Fort Thomas, Kentucky. They have six step-grandchildren, and six step-great-grandchildren. Andy has several nieces and nephews, all loved very much.
Andy worked for the Ohio Historical Society (now known as Ohio History Connection) based at Serpent Mound from 1974 – 2003 when he retired. He operated his own electric, plumbing and repair business, Andy’s Electric & Repair, for 35 years. He was a lifelong horseman, farmer and gardener. He so enjoyed sharing his produce with friends and neighbors, doing what he liked most, talking and visiting and helping out when he could. Andy made friends wherever he went.
Andy loved animals of all kinds, particularly horses and dogs. He participated in Boy Scout Troop 266 of Peebles with his son. He enjoyed showing horses with his daughter in 4-H.
Andy always had an abiding belief in God and His goodness.
